    You must avoid twisting the brake line so always connect it at the calliper side first and then put some alignment marking to assist the connection at the brake pipe side.

    Had lots of fun releasing the brake hose from the pipe fitting.


    So much rust and corrosion but thanks to the Acetone-ATF mixture, managed to release them at the end....
